    As others have stated, you want to contact your local co-op extension if you're in the states.

    https://extension.org/find-cooperative-extension-in-your-state/

    The Cooperative Extension System is a non-formal educational program implemented in the United States designed to help people use research-based knowledge to improve their lives. The service is provided by the state's designated land-grant universities. In most states, the educational offerings are in the areas of agriculture and food, home and family, environment, community economic development, and youth and 4-H. (wiki)

    They'll have free soil sample kits, articles and programs/classes for local agriculture, etc etc.

    Anything else will be pirated, shitty ad filled ai knockoff apps, or finding a forum of like minded individuals you can ask. There are plenty of resources out there but a "one stop shop" I haven't found. The problem stems probably from location, information is vast and mostly irrelevant if you're not in the same growing zones. The local co-ops will have individuals, employees, and articles posted up, they're really helpful when it comes to reaching out to them in my experience.

    It gets worse, for the national HSR they've doubled down with a privatized high-end train line (think first class, private lobbies for premium etc) with a horrible "track" record in Florida.

    Dubbed the deadliest train per mile in America by the Associated Press, Brightline has killed dozens of people (link)

    New York-based Fortress Investment Group, which owns Brightline via its Florida East Coast Industries (FECI) unit, has pursued a strategy of mixing its infrastructure play with large-scale, real estate investments. Coral Gables-based FECI has developed multifamily and office buildings near Brightline stations and sold most of these projects to institutional investors at nine-figure prices. It also has a sizable portfolio of land and real estate holdings along the train line.... “I think Brightline was a real estate play. I think it always has been,” said Bradley Arendt (link)

    So a deadly company that refuses safety precautions (forced the government to fund further safety regulations), and is managed and owned by huge financial companies that own the real estate making their own government funded mini-monopoly rail line and estates! Oh yeah, they're way over budget and losing money fast, but if they can just get that sweet "build back America" funding they can squeeze the company for a few more years before the high priced investors can cut ties and run with their profits.

    Stargate Theme Park ride- SG 3000 (Bremen Space Center and Six Flags) https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=W5dxCJ1WX0M

    This is the official ride video that was thankfully saved. If anyone has VR and has watched it like that let me know how it went! From [Stargate fandom wiki](https://stargate.fandom.com/wiki/Stargate_SG-3000) > - a simulator thrill ride based around the highly successful MGM television series Stargate SG-1 that made its debut at The Space Center in Bremen and Germany in December, 2003. A reproduction has now been built at Six Flags Kentucky Kingdom, Six Flags Great America and Six Flags Marine World (which is now Six Flags Discovery Kingdom). As of 2006, Six Flags Great America no longer shows Stargate SG-3000. > - 3000 years after the events of Stargate SG-1, the Stargate Network has long since been shut down by the Asgard. However, the network now becomes active again and the stored consciousness of General George S. Hammond reactivates to guide new SG team members through the gate to stop Satra, the daughter of Apophis who wishes to get revenge for the death of her father. It's... interesting what they were trying to do with the IP. Apparently in 2021 the simulator was [purchased](https://darkridedatabase.com/rides/stargate-sg-3000/) by Hennie van der Most to be installed at Attractiepark Rotterdam (hard to follow the trail after that without translations but doubt they have the rights to show the old ride). Some other interesting things to note: From [CoasterBuzz](https://coasterbuzz.com/Forums/Topic/mgm-and-six-flags-launching-stargate-themed-interactive-rides) (2004) > MGM's syndicated Stargate SG-1 television show will be the basis for a simulator film showing at three Six Flags parks this year, including Marine World, Kentucky Kingdom and Great America. Stargate SG 3000 features a four-minute simulation film that lets audiences experience what happens when they soar through the Stargate into different dimensions. The 20-minute overall guest experience includes a themed queuing area, the mission briefing/pre-show and the motion simulator theater. [Facebook link](https://www.facebook.com/114317091949414/photos/a.3175168412530918/3175168909197535/) to a set of photos taken while the exhibit was open, includes the queue area and a shot of the "pre-show". The original [Trailer](https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=HkqFHOifJXQ) for the ride - Also hoping to find the original pre-show and more information on the rides setup, no hits so far though.
